这些小活动你都参加了吗?快来围观一下吧!>>
电子产品世界 » 论坛首页 » 嵌入式开发 » MCU » 请问M0516如何对Flash里面的内容进行加密?

共2条 1/1 1 跳转至

请问M0516如何对Flash里面的内容进行加密?

工程师
2024-10-19 19:01:02     打赏

M0516如何对Flash里面的内容进行加密?请高手指点




关键词: M0516     Flash     微控制器    

助工
2024-10-19 19:01:29     打赏
2楼

1. 使用软件加密算法:在编程中使用软件实现加密算法,对需要加密的数据进行加密处理,然后再存储到Flash中。解密时,将加密数据读取出来并进行解密操作。这种方法的优点是灵活,可以根据需要选择合适的加密算法,但效率较低。

2. 使用硬件加密模块:M0516可以通过外部的硬件加密模块来对Flash内容进行加密。硬件加密模块通常具有更高的处理速度和更强的安全性,能够提供更好的保护。但需要在设计时考虑选用支持硬件加密的硬件模块。

3. 使用专用工具进行加密:一些专用的开发工具可以对Flash内容进行加密,如Keil、IAR等集成开发环境中的加密功能。这些工具通常具有简单易用的界面,可以方便地对Flash内容进行加密操作。

需要注意的是,加密只能增加攻击者获取数据的难度,但并不能完全保证数据的安全性。攻击者可以尝试使用各种方法进行破解。因此,除了加密,还需要考虑其他安全性措施,如数字签名、访问权限控制等。 


共2条 1/1 1 跳转至

回复

匿名不能发帖!请先 [ 登陆 注册 ]